Transaction e4f60ccabe59baf2634fa25859ccc1224c2f9ae0e304b0d2b7f5346b86c49183
1 Input
1 Output
-
e4f60ccabe59baf2634fa25859ccc1224c2f9ae0e304b0d2b7f5346b86c49183:0
- value
- 35775879
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3101594b48e741fa10a4467f78a6ac4c3d09db1
- address
- bc1q6vgpt9953e6plgg2g3nl0zn2cnpap8d3v5mw7q